The Centre for Alternative Technology (CAT) is an environmental charity dedicated to sharing solutions and inspiring, informing and enabling action on the climate and biodiversity crisis. CAT is a place of hope, to grow the knowledge and skills needed to create a safer, healthier and fairer future.

    The past 10 years have been the hottest on record, extreme weather events increasingly punctuate our calendars, and one in six species in the UK are at risk of extinction. Regularly scrolling through stark statistics like these leaves many of us feeling helpless, hopeless, and unable to make a difference. This is the problem that CAT continues to address. At CAT, we help people to overcome these feelings by giving them the knowledge and skills they need to take action and make a difference.

    At CAT, learners of all ages can feel nourished by nature. This helps them to realise their own agency and sense of purpose in the face of global challenges. Once a disused quarry, CAT has been transformed into somewhere where nature thrives, with rich gardens, woodlands, and wildlife alongside innovative technology. By helping to cultivate this extraordinary place, our volunteers engage in a beautiful reciprocal relationship that inspires and energises them to make change.
